He is the CEO of IVAX Corporation, which was acquired by TEVA Pharmaceuticals, and she served as chair of the Smithsonian National Board. The couple is a huge supporter of the arts, evidenced by their $33 million donation to the University of Miami that led to the Frost School of Music—the largest gift ever made to a university-based music school in the United States. The couple’s additional donation to Florida International University resulted in the school’s art museum being renamed The Patricia & Phillip Frost Art Museum. Adding to their list of eponymous museums is the new Miami Science Museum, which was dubbed the Patricia and Phillip Frost Museum of Science, thanks to a $35 million donation by the philanthropic couple.
